Understanding the Chow Chow

The Chow Chow is a breed of Chinese origin that is known for its distinctive lion-like mane and blue-black tongue. This ancient breed was originally used for hunting and guarding, and its strong protective instincts are still evident today. Chow Chows are known for their aloof nature and can be wary of strangers, making them excellent guard dogs.

In terms of appearance, Chow Chows are medium-sized dogs with a sturdy build and a dense double coat that can come in a variety of colors, including red, black, blue, and cinnamon. They have a unique scowling expression and a distinctive rolling gait that sets them apart from other breeds.

Exploring the Skye Terrier

The Skye Terrier, on the other hand, is a Scottish breed that is known for its long, flowing coat and elegant appearance. Skye Terriers are affectionate and loyal dogs that form strong bonds with their families. They are also known for their playful and mischievous nature, making them a favorite among dog owners.

With their distinctive double coat and prick ears, Skye Terriers are easily recognizable. They come in a variety of colors, including black, blue, gray, and fawn. Skye Terriers are energetic and inquisitive dogs that enjoy exploring their surroundings and engaging in playful activities.

The Chow Chow and Skye Terrier Crossbreed

When you combine the traits of the Chow Chow and Skye Terrier, you get a unique crossbreed that is both loyal and playful. The Chow Chow's protective instincts are tempered by the Skye Terrier's outgoing nature, creating a dog that is both loving and alert. This crossbreed is known for its intelligence and trainability, making it a great choice for families looking for a versatile companion.

In terms of appearance, Chow Chow and Skye Terrier mixes can vary widely depending on which traits they inherit from each parent. Some may have the Chow Chow's distinctive blue-black tongue and lion-like mane, while others may have the Skye Terrier's long, flowing coat and elegant appearance.
